Younger looking skin secrets revealed!
Smooth, perfect, younger looking skin is no longer a privilege of the wealthy. Nowadays, anyone can have a flawless complexion until later in life. There is no one secret to youthful skin. It all comes down to the choices you make every day. Smoking, stress, alcohol consumption and poor sleep affect skin health, causing premature ageing. A balanced lifestyle and good nutrition can make all the difference.
Here are some simple tips to achieve younger looking skin and slow down ageing:
Ditch Bad Lifestyle Habits
Smoking and alcohol consumption are often the culprits behind premature ageing. The chemicals in cigarette smoke increase toxic load and affect oxygen flow to your skin, which promotes the formation of wrinkles. Another common problem is sleep deprivation. Your skin heals itself at night. If you don’t get enough rest, you may experience premature ageing, sagging skin, dark spots, and dull complexion.
Load Up on Vitamin C
A recent study conducted on women over the age of 40 has found that those who consumed more vitamin C were less likely to develop wrinkles. This nutrient benefits your skin in a multitude of ways. It not only slows down ageing, but also boosts collagen synthesis, fights inflammation, and supports skin repair. To get more vitamin C in your diet, load up on berries, citrus fruits, cruciferous veggies, and leafy greens.

Use Quality Skin Care Products
The chemicals in makeup and personal care products are absorbed into your skin and end up in the bloodstream. Poor quality creams and lotions may cause long-term damage to the skin. Invest in a few basic products with anti-aging ingredients, such as retinol, beta-carotene, vitamin C, and hyaluronic acid. Use organic creams and treatments whenever possible.
Stay Hydrated
Every cell in your body needs water to survive. Your skin is over 64 percent water. Thus, proper hydration is crucial for skin health. Even the slightest dehydration can affect your complexion, energy levels, and mental focus. For young-looking skin, drink plenty of water, unsweetened tea, green smoothies, and freshly squeezed fruit juices. Rich in antioxidants, fruit-infused water is a great choice too.
